not wanting to sound negative, but I don't believe the bolded part. if you are so sure you can maintain 185 @ 11-12% bf, then if you start eating today how you intend to maintain it, you will slowly loose the weight and end up at 185. if you have a hard time loosing in the first place, you'll have a harder time maintaining at 250-300 calories less a day your body will need.

so putting that aside, if you feel the need to chew something go with green veggies like broccoli, celery, lettuce, etc. and stick to the shakes for protein if you are trying to do a velocity related. Even eat one meal of solid food a day, thats a reasonable variant so long as you track the calories. MRBs tend to not have the greatest nutrition profile, so I try to avoid them.
 
works pretty well, and you can use a lot of greens in that one meal. So a lean chicken breast or fish fillet plus spinach and other mixed greens and veggies gives nice fill factor and gets you some of the chew factor in for the day. i've tried it, worked pretty well. nothing has worked too well since I went below 15% bf tho :P
